首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何修复Google Colab中的“TypeError: print()接受1个位置参数,但给出了5个”

在Google Colab中修复“TypeError: print()接受1个位置参数,但给出了5个”错误,可以按照以下步骤进行:

  1. 检查代码中的print语句:首先,需要检查代码中的print语句,确保没有给print函数传递了多个参数。print函数在Python中只接受一个位置参数,如果给出了多个参数,就会出现该错误。
  2. 检查变量类型:如果代码中的print语句只有一个参数,但仍然出现了该错误,可能是因为参数的类型不正确。print函数只能接受字符串类型的参数,如果传递了其他类型的参数,就会出现该错误。可以使用type()函数检查参数的类型,并确保参数是字符串类型。
  3. 使用字符串格式化:如果参数的类型正确,但仍然出现该错误,可能是因为参数中包含了特殊字符或格式化字符串。可以尝试使用字符串格式化来确保参数的正确输出。例如,可以使用%s占位符将参数插入到字符串中。
  4. 检查代码逻辑:如果以上步骤都没有解决问题,可能是代码逻辑出现了错误。可以仔细检查代码中的逻辑,确保print语句在正确的位置和条件下执行。

总结: 修复Google Colab中的“TypeError: print()接受1个位置参数,但给出了5个”错误,需要检查代码中的print语句,确保没有给print函数传递多个参数。同时,还需要检查参数的类型,确保参数是字符串类型。如果参数类型正确,可以尝试使用字符串格式化来确保参数的正确输出。如果问题仍然存在,需要仔细检查代码逻辑,确保print语句在正确的位置和条件下执行。

注意:以上答案中没有提及云计算品牌商的相关产品和链接地址,如有需要,请提供具体的问题和要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

TensorFlow被曝存在严重bug,搭配Keras可能丢失权重,用户反映一个月仍未修复

也就是说,原本需要训练权重现在被冻结了。 让这位工程师感到不满是,他大约一个月前在GitHub把这个bug报告谷歌,结果谷歌官方到现在还没有修复。 ?...解决办法 如何检验自己代码是否会出现类似问题呢?...Gupta还自己用Transformer库创建模型bug在Colab笔记本复现了,有兴趣读者可以前去观看。...https://colab.research.google.com/gist/Santosh-Gupta/40c54e5b76e3f522fa78da6a248b6826/missingtrainablevarsinference_var.ipynb...为了检查谷歌最近是否修复了该漏洞,Gupta还安装了Nightly版TF 2.3.0-rc1,保持框架处于最新状态,如今bug依然存在。

70540

如何免费云端运行Python深度学习框架?

好了,现在Colab已经接管了你Google Drive了。我们Google Drive云端硬盘根目录起个名字,叫做drive。 !mkdir -p drive !...这确实是个问题,是否是因为TuriCreateSFrame数据框在Colab上有些水土不服?目前我还不能确定。 好在咱们样例文件总数不多,还能接受。 ? 终于读取完毕了。...我们看看data包含哪些数据吧。 data 跟Jupyter Notebook本地运行结果一致,都是文件路径,以及图片尺寸信息。 ? 下面,我们还是图片打标记。...还是老样子,50层深度神经网络模型,已经无法让人直观理解。所以我们无法确切查明究竟是哪个判定环节上出了问题。 然而直观猜测,我们发现在整个照片里,方方正正瓦力根本就不占主要位置。...; 如何将数据和代码通过Google Drive迁移到Colab如何Colab安装缺失软件包; 如何Colab找到数据文件路径。

4.5K10

机器“不肯”学习,怎么办?

从留言反馈来看,有读者能够正确指出了问题。 很遗憾,我没有能见到有人提出正确和完整解决方案。 这篇文章,咱们就来谈谈,机器为什么“不肯学习”?以及怎么做,才能让它“学得进去”。...这样就可以先把它在你自己 Google Drive 存好,以便使用和回顾。 ? Colab 为你提供了全套运行环境。你只需要依次执行代码,就可以复现本教程运行结果了。...如果你对 Google Colab 不熟悉,没关系。我这里有一篇教程,专门讲解 Google Colab 特点与使用方式。...为了你能够更为深入地学习与了解代码,我建议你在 Google Colab 开启一个全新 Notebook ,并且根据下文,依次输入代码并运行。在此过程,充分理解代码含义。...例如类别1 Recall 简直惨不忍睹。 有没有什么办法改进呢? 这个问题,就需要你了解如何微调模型,以及超参数设定了。 如果你需要详细学习资料,推荐给你这本经典教材。

56940

GPT-2大规模部署:AI Dungeon 2 如何支撑百万级用户

尽管 GPT-2 是可用最强大模型,实际上还远远不够。经过几个月修复和调整,我游戏有了很大改进,还是遇到了同样问题。...如何在 GCP 上花费 50000 美元 当我第一次发布 AI Dungeon 2 时,它并不是一个托管应用,而是一个用户可以复制并运行 Google Colab notebook,用户可以下载 AI...图片来源:Google Colab 这种方法之所以有意义,有几个原因。首先,Colab 是免费,这使得它成为了一个很好辅助项目平台。...其次,Google 为每个 Colab notebook 提供了一个免费 GPU 实例,这是运行 5GB 模型所必需。 我们遇到第一个问题是我们模型几乎不适合 GPU 实例。...经过一些修复,我们能够使我们 Cortex 部署比以前 Colab 设置成本效益高出大约 90%。在两周内,我们服务器数量达到了 715 台峰值,我们支持了超过 10 万名玩家。

1.5K30

一文教你读懂 Python 异常信息

然后,greet 函数接受一个 someone 和一个可选 greeting,之后调用 print 函数,在 print 调用 who_to_greet 函数并传入参数 someone。...str 在本例引发异常同样是一个类型错误,这一次消息帮助要小一些。...我们需要往上阅读错误信息,才能确定错误具体位置。这里我们得知错误代码是 a_list[3]原因是索引3 超出了列表范围,因为最大就是1(索引下标从0 开始)。...TypeError 当你代码试图对一个无法执行此操作对象执行某些操作时,例如将字符串添加到整数,以及一开始例子使用 append 方法元组添加元素,这些都会引发 TypeError。...括号理面详细写了你希望解包3个值实际上只了2 个。 第二个示例,错误信息行是解包太多值。

2.4K10

20种小技巧,玩转Google Colab

选自amitness.com 作者:Amit Chaudhary 机器之心编译 编辑:陈萍 Google Colab 广大 AI 开发者提供了免费 GPU,你可以在上面轻松地跑 Tensorflow...关于 Colab 使用技巧你又掌握了多少呢?这篇文章将介绍 20 种 Colab 使用技巧,帮你提高使用效率。 ? 1....Jupyter Notebook 快捷键 快捷键为编程带来了便利, Jupyter Notebook 快捷键不能直接在 Colab 中使用。不过,这里有一个关系映射表来解决这一问题。...在 GitHub 打开 Notebooks Google Colab 团队提供了官方 Chrome 扩展程序。使用 colab 时,可以直接在 GitHub 上打开 notebooks。...只要接受它,即使你在另一个选项卡、窗口或应用程序上,colab 也会在任务完成时通知你。 19.

2.4K20

玩转Google Colab!附20种小技巧

本文转载自:机器之心 作者:Amit Chaudhary | 编辑:陈萍 Google Colab 广大 AI 开发者提供了免费 GPU,你可以在上面轻松地跑 Tensorflow、Pytorch...关于 Colab 使用技巧你又掌握了多少呢?这篇文章将介绍 20 种 Colab 使用技巧,帮你提高使用效率。 ? 1....Jupyter Notebook 快捷键 快捷键为编程带来了便利, Jupyter Notebook 快捷键不能直接在 Colab 中使用。不过,这里有一个关系映射表来解决这一问题。...在 GitHub 打开 Notebooks Google Colab 团队提供了官方 Chrome 扩展程序。使用 colab 时,可以直接在 GitHub 上打开 notebooks。...只要接受它,即使你在另一个选项卡、窗口或应用程序上,colab 也会在任务完成时通知你。 19.

3.9K31

20种小技巧,玩转Google Colab

选自amitness.com,作者:Amit Chaudhary 机器之心编译 Google Colab 广大 AI 开发者提供了免费 GPU,你可以在上面轻松地跑 Tensorflow、Pytorch...关于 Colab 使用技巧你又掌握了多少呢?这篇文章将介绍 20 种 Colab 使用技巧,帮你提高使用效率。 1....Jupyter Notebook 快捷键 快捷键为编程带来了便利, Jupyter Notebook 快捷键不能直接在 Colab 中使用。不过,这里有一个关系映射表来解决这一问题。...在 GitHub 打开 Notebooks Google Colab 团队提供了官方 Chrome 扩展程序。使用 colab 时,可以直接在 GitHub 上打开 notebooks。...只要接受它,即使你在另一个选项卡、窗口或应用程序上,colab 也会在任务完成时通知你。 19.

1.9K20

浅谈python出错时traceback解读

虽然 Python Traceback 提示信息看着挺复杂,但是里面丰富信息,可以帮助你诊断和修复代码引发异常原因,以及定位到具体哪个文件哪行代码出现错误,所以说学会看懂 Traceback...然而,有些代码错误信息要比这个复杂多。 如何阅读 Python Traceback 信息?...然后,greet 函数接受一个 someone 和一个可选 greeting,之后调用 print 函数,在 print 调用 who_to_greet 函数并传入参数 someone。...(Pycharm 通过点击文件链接可以定位到具体位置) 在这个例子,因为我们代码没有使用任何其他 Python 模块,所以我们在这里看到<module ,它表示所处位置是在执行文件。...在本例引发异常同样是一个类型错误,这一次消息帮助要小一些。

1.7K40

20种小技巧,玩转Google Colab

选自amitness.com 作者:Amit Chaudhary 机器之心编译 编辑:陈萍 Google Colab 广大 AI 开发者提供了免费 GPU,你可以在上面轻松地跑 Tensorflow...关于 Colab 使用技巧你又掌握了多少呢?这篇文章将介绍 20 种 Colab 使用技巧,帮你提高使用效率。 ? 1....Jupyter Notebook 快捷键 快捷键为编程带来了便利, Jupyter Notebook 快捷键不能直接在 Colab 中使用。不过,这里有一个关系映射表来解决这一问题。...在 GitHub 打开 Notebooks Google Colab 团队提供了官方 Chrome 扩展程序。使用 colab 时,可以直接在 GitHub 上打开 notebooks。...只要接受它,即使你在另一个选项卡、窗口或应用程序上,colab 也会在任务完成时通知你。 19.

3.2K31

使用 OpenCV 进行图像性别预测和年龄检测

应用 在监控计算机视觉,经常使用年龄和性别预测。计算机视觉进步使这一预测变得更加实用,更容易为公众所接受。由于其在智能现实世界应用实用性,该研究课题取得了重大进展。...实施 现在让我们学习如何使用 Python OpenCV 库通过相机或图片输入来确定年龄和性别。 使用框架是 Caffe,用于使用原型文件创建模型。...import cv2_imshow 第 2 步:在框架查找边界框坐标 使用下面的用户定义函数,我们可以获得边界框坐标,也可以说人脸在图像位置。...下面的用户定义函数是 pipline 或者我们可以说是主要工作流程实现,在该工作流程,图像进入函数以获取位置,并进一步预测年龄范围和性别。...在这篇文章,我们学习了如何创建一个年龄预测器,它也可以检测你脸并用边框突出显示。

1.6K20

Python函数参数传递机制

过量位置参数使用星号(*)加变量名形式(*args),在传递多余2个参数时候,前两个参数分别赋值了a和b,后面的参数都将整体赋值args,通过打印可以看出,args是一个元祖类型,所以可以通过遍历将里面的数据取出来使用...,在过量关键字参数也是,kwargs只接受键值对形式参数,所以像107和108这两种调用方式就会出错,值1和2分别赋值了a和b,后面的c=1和d=2通过kwargs来接受,剩余3没有形式参数接受...因为**kwargs值接受键值对形式参数。...4赋值了a,剩下两个值2和3分别赋值b和c,这是错误,在这种混合模式下,赋值顺序必须是先位置参数->默认值参数->过量位置参数->过量关键字参数,否则就会出错。...: demo() got multiple values for keyword argument 'a' 上面[126]调用时候,通过一个元祖包装了2个参数值,1赋值形参a,元祖args2,3

1K20

Python argparse 模块

从这四个命令我们可以学到一些概念: ls 命令在不接受任何参数时也是有作用,它默认用于展示当前目录下内容。 如果我们想它让提供非默认以外功能,我们必须指定更多参数。...在这个例子,我们想要展示一个不同目录:pypy。我们所做是指定所谓位置参数。之所以这样命名,是因为程序仅根据命令行位置知道该值用途。...然而请注意,尽管帮助信息看起来不错,目前并不是很有用。例如,我们看到了我们将 echo 作为了位置参数除了猜测和阅读源代码外,我们不知道它作用。...可选参数介绍 到目前为止,我们已经介绍过了位置参数。...正如我们认为一样,当我们使用长选项,输出结果仍然是一样。 然而,我们帮助信息对这一个新功能解释得不是很好,这一点仍旧是可以通过修改脚本代码来修复(通过 help 关键字)。

1K20

如何Google Colab 练 Python?

这款工具,就是 Google Colab 。我曾经在《如何免费云端运行Python深度学习框架?》一文为你介绍过它,在《如何用 Python 和循环神经网络做中文文本分类?》...下面,我给你介绍一下,如何Google Colab 应对上述4个痛点,为你 Python 练习提供辅助。 环境 新手最常见问题,就是好不容易累积了学习兴趣,上手不久便遇到报错。...如果你尝试过,便可能有一种错觉——这些 Python 高手很不友好。因为你贴了问题,却没人理你。 其实,这很可能是你问问题方式不对。...有没有高效方法? 当然有。依然利用我们刚才已经见到过共享功能。 ? 只是这一次,在选择权限时候,对方“可修改”权限。 ? 例如还是刚才 print 命令没有加括号问题。...一文,我给你推荐过经典教材《笨办法学 Python》吧? 《笨办法学 Python》指出了一条看似笨拙,却非常有效学习路径。

1.8K20

教程 | 如何利用Google Colab免费训练StarCraft II

选自Medium 作者:Franklin He 机器之心编译 参与:Nurhachu Null、路 本文介绍了如何Google ColabGoogle 提供免费 GPU 机器学习环境)上运行 StarCraft...第一个猜想:没有找到需要库 我最初猜测是,StarCraft II 作为一个游戏,可能需要某些 OpenGL 函数和库,而这些并不包含在我所用 Google Colab 环境。...快速搜索如何调试段错误使我想起了 Valgrind(http://valgrind.org/),令我惊讶是,该工具竟然可以在 Google Colab 上使用。...它在 Google Colab 上会是什么样子呢...... ? 解决方案 不幸是,设置 LD_PRELOAD 环境变量并不能传播到环境其他部分。 通过执行以下命令: !...我已经在 Google Colab 上提出了这个 bug(https://github.com/googlecolab/colabtools/issues/106),因此我们以后不必为此大费周折了。

1.7K70
领券